About This Item
Fair HC, no DJ. Tan cloth over boards, black titles on spine. Scuffed, lightly soiled covers and spine; tightly bound and square in case; owner name and address on front free end paper; fairly heavily notated in red pencil throughout; few dog-eared leaves; otherwise light, clean interior. 8vo, 221 pp. See, OCLC #2147423.
